Halawa, a community in Honolulu County, Hawaii, has 13,809 residents. Its median household income of $102,987 runs in line with the Honolulu County figure of $104,264.
From 2019 to 2023, Halawa's population declined 4.5% from 14,453 to 13,809, while its median home value rose 28.0% from $785,200 to $1,005,400.
The largest age group is 25 to 34, 14.5% of residents. Asian residents are the largest group, 54.8% of the population.
